CÍRCULO CREATIVO USA
ANNOUNCES NEW LEADERSHIP 2026-2027
VERÓNICA ELIZONDO ASSUMES PRESIDENCY
AND JAVIER OSORIO BECOMES VICE PRESIDENT
Miami, FL (January 19, 2026) – Círculo Creativo USA announced today that Verónica Elizondo has been elected as president and Javier Osorio as vice president for the 2026-2027 term, marking the beginning of a new era of growth and expansion for the organization.
Verónica Elizondo, Chief Creative Officer at Conill, brings over 25 years of experience in advertising and design. Since joining Conill in 2005 as an art director, she has led memorable campaigns for brands including Burger King, Alaska Airlines, Aflac, Budweiser, T-Mobile, and Toyota. Her work has been recognized with awards at Cannes Lions, D&AD, Clios, One Show, FIAP, El Sol, and Effie Awards. Digiday named her among the "5 Hispanic agency creatives you should know." She created the iconic "Más Que Un Auto" (More Than A Car) campaign for Toyota, which celebrated the automaker's tenth consecutive year as the leading brand among Latinos and generated the highest volume of user-generated content in the brand's history.
She began her professional career in her hometown of Monterrey, Mexico. After spending a summer in Milan, Italy, where she completed a graphic advertising program, she moved to Miami, where she completed her portfolio in art direction.

Javier Osorio is a creative director and copywriter with over 20 years of experience in the advertising industry. He has worked at multiple agencies for global and local brands, and his work has been recognized at festivals including Cannes Lions, FIAP, Effie Awards, Radio Mercury Awards, New York Festivals, and Communication Arts. He has also served as a juror at El Ojo de Iberoamérica, AdStars, National ADDYs, Radio Mercury Awards, and Effie Awards, among others.
